Set in London in 1940, during the height of the Blitz, Catrin (Gemma Arterton) thinks she’s applying for a secretarial position when she walks into the British Ministry of Information’s film division. But when her supervisor (Richard E. Grant) learns that she has experience as a newspaper copywriter, he hires her for what he surely considers a much worse position: as a writer of “slop” — an old screenwriter’s code for dialogue between women — for the propaganda shorts that run between features at cinemas. With the country's morale at stake, Catrin, Buckley and a colourful crew work furiously to make a film that will warm the hearts of the nation. As bombs are dropping all around them, Catrin discovers there is as much drama, comedy and passion behind the camera as there is onscreen.
